I have no idea why I even signed up for this. Is the money worth it? To be trapped here on this cold godforsaken planet without any of the proper resources needed? Most would say no, but the money was good, enough that I could retire and never have to worry about a thing. The young woman thought as she tightened the fur-lined coat tighter around her body. She had pilfered it in a market two planets back, and now she wished she had the forethought to gather more cold weather gear.She had nothing to cover her face, but she wished she had. She could feel the bite of the wind as it chapped her skin.

She had convinced herself and the others that she was hunting down this convict for nothing more than the paycheck. She was lying to them all. The only person more dangerous than she was, was the man they were hunting. He was the most feared convict in the entire universe, and no slam had been able to hold him. Oh yes, she understood just who she was going after, but that didn't matter. They'd made a promise to each other that if they were ever to get separated, they would come looking for the other. Even if it meant that she had to travel halfway across the galaxy.

She had tracked his trail down here to this cold planet, but he was long gone. Oh, she had an idea where he was, and she knew they were coming for her. She just had to bide her time. That was easier said than done considering she was stuck here. The ship she had been on crashed, and she was the only one that managed to survive. Of course it the damned pilot had listened to her they wouldn't’ have hit the outcropping that jutted out at them. She was a woman though, and most mercs that were men didn't pay her any mind. They couldn't possibly believe that she knew what she was talking about.

So instead she just wandered back to her cave, hoping to find someone that would find her. In the back of her mind, she had a nagging feeling that he was on his way and it would only be a matter of time. She needed to hold out, to keep herself calm as she waited. Inside her cave, it was warmer, and there was food if you knew where to find it. For some strange reason, the ice that surrounded this planet could be warm enough if you buried yourself deep enough. Time was the only factor. Could she hold out long enough for his return?

For so long she had been the hunted, but now she was the hunter, the predator, the alpha. Only, she was so far out of her league that it was clear the man she was searching for would be nothing if not her final stand. He was not the type of person that a normal bounty hunter went for. Then again, she had a connection to him that none of the others had. Would he find her?
